Problem

Current anti-aging cosmetic compositions can only slow down the appearance of skin aging symptoms but fail to effectively prevent and repair the effects of skin aging, with limited effectiveness in addressing natural or externally induced aging.

Innovation Solution

A cosmetic composition containing a compound of a specific general formula that stimulates anti-aging cellular functions by inducing the overexpression of genes promoting anti-aging proteins and inhibiting genes causing aging, thereby enhancing skin barrier function and protein synthesis.

AI summary

The invention relates to the use of a compound of general formula (I), where: R1, R2, R3, R4, R5 are identical or different and each represent a hydrogen atom, a halogen atom, a hydroxyl group or an -OR' radical in which R' is a straight or branched, saturated or unsaturated C1-C16 hydrocarbon radical, wherein at least one group from among R1, R2, R3, R4, and R5 does not represent a hydrogen atom or a halogen atom; X is a halogen atom, a hydroxyl group, a nitro group, a straight or branched, saturated or unsaturated optionally substituted C1-C14 hydrocarbon radical, or an -OR'' radical in which R'' is a straight or branched, saturated or unsaturated optionally substituted C1-C14 hydrocarbon radical; and Z is a covalent bond or a spacer arm, or of one of the salts thereof, in a cosmetic composition for stimulating the cellular anti-aging functions of the skin.
